注冊(cè) | 登錄讀書好,好讀書,讀好書!
讀書網(wǎng)-DuShu.com
當(dāng)前位置: 首頁(yè)出版圖書科學(xué)技術(shù)計(jì)算機(jī)/網(wǎng)絡(luò)軟件與程序設(shè)計(jì)匯編語(yǔ)言/編譯原理80x86匯編語(yǔ)言與計(jì)算機(jī)體系結(jié)構(gòu)

80x86匯編語(yǔ)言與計(jì)算機(jī)體系結(jié)構(gòu)

80x86匯編語(yǔ)言與計(jì)算機(jī)體系結(jié)構(gòu)

定 價(jià):¥49.00

作 者: (美)戴默;鄭紅譯
出版社: 機(jī)械工業(yè)出版社
叢編項(xiàng): 計(jì)算機(jī)科學(xué)叢書
標(biāo) 簽: 匯編語(yǔ)言程序設(shè)計(jì)

ISBN: 9787111176176 出版時(shí)間: 2006-01-01 包裝: 平裝
開本: 16開 頁(yè)數(shù): 332 字?jǐn)?shù):  

內(nèi)容簡(jiǎn)介

  本書在當(dāng)前操作系統(tǒng)采用的平面32位地址環(huán)境中介紹了80x86匯編語(yǔ)言和計(jì)算機(jī)體系結(jié)構(gòu),重點(diǎn)介紹32位平面內(nèi)存模型,強(qiáng)調(diào)了體系結(jié)構(gòu)的概念,如寄存器、內(nèi)存編址、硬件功能等,涵蓋了匯編語(yǔ)言的指令、分支和循環(huán)、過(guò)程、位運(yùn)算、匯編過(guò)程,輸入/輸出等重點(diǎn)內(nèi)容,并增加了高級(jí)語(yǔ)言的概念,同時(shí)理論結(jié)合實(shí)例,注重關(guān)鍵知識(shí)點(diǎn)練習(xí)與編程實(shí)踐。.本書適合作為高等院校相關(guān)專業(yè)的教材以及參考書,也可供工程技術(shù)人員參考。..本書從計(jì)算機(jī)的結(jié)構(gòu)層討論80x86匯編語(yǔ)言與計(jì)算機(jī)體系結(jié)構(gòu),并提供了許多匯編語(yǔ)言代碼的例子,便于讀者在匯編語(yǔ)言層面上學(xué)習(xí)和掌握計(jì)算機(jī)體系結(jié)構(gòu)。本書還集中介紹了高級(jí)語(yǔ)言中的一些概念以及一些操作系統(tǒng)的功能,并簡(jiǎn)要描述了在硬件層用到的邏輯門。另外,本書考察了匯編語(yǔ)言如何翻譯為機(jī)器語(yǔ)言,為讀者進(jìn)一步學(xué)習(xí)計(jì)算機(jī)程序設(shè)計(jì)和體系結(jié)構(gòu)打下基礎(chǔ),有助于用任何編程語(yǔ)言有效地進(jìn)行編程,激發(fā)讀者對(duì)計(jì)算機(jī)設(shè)計(jì)和體系結(jié)構(gòu)進(jìn)行更進(jìn)一步的研究,或者更多地了解某個(gè)特定計(jì)算機(jī)系統(tǒng)的詳細(xì)內(nèi)容。...

作者簡(jiǎn)介

  Richard C.Detmer于1966年畢業(yè)于肯塔基大學(xué),后于威斯康星大學(xué)獲碩士學(xué)位和博士學(xué)位,現(xiàn)任中田納西州大學(xué)計(jì)算機(jī)科學(xué)系教授和系主任。

圖書目錄

Richard C. Detmer
第1章  計(jì)算機(jī)中數(shù)的表示        1
1.1 二進(jìn)制和十六進(jìn)制數(shù)        1
1.2 字符編碼        4
1.3 有符號(hào)整數(shù)的二進(jìn)制補(bǔ)碼表示        6
1.4 二進(jìn)制補(bǔ)碼數(shù)的加減法        9
1.5 數(shù)的其他表示法        13
本章小結(jié)        15
第2章  計(jì)算機(jī)系統(tǒng)的組成        17
2.1 微機(jī)硬件:存儲(chǔ)器        17
2.2 微機(jī)的硬件:CPU        18
2.3 微機(jī)硬件:輸入/輸出設(shè)備        22
2.4 PC軟件        23
本章小結(jié)        25
第3章  匯編語(yǔ)言的要素        26
3.1 匯編語(yǔ)句        26
3.2 一個(gè)完整的實(shí)例        28
3.3 程序的匯編、鏈接和運(yùn)行        33
3.4 匯編器清單文件        38
3.5 常數(shù)操作數(shù)        43
3.6 指令中的操作數(shù)        46
3.7 使用IO.H中宏的輸入/輸出        49
本章小結(jié)        52
第4章 基本指令        54
4.1 復(fù)制數(shù)據(jù)指令        54
4.2 整數(shù)的加法和減法指令        61
4.3 乘法指令        69
4.4 除法指令        76
4.5 大數(shù)的加減        84
4.6 其他知識(shí):微代碼抽象級(jí)        86
本章小結(jié)        87
第5章  分支和循環(huán)        88
5.1 無(wú)條件轉(zhuǎn)移        88
5.2 條件轉(zhuǎn)移、比較指令和if結(jié)構(gòu)        92
5.3 循環(huán)結(jié)構(gòu)的實(shí)現(xiàn)        103
5.4 匯編語(yǔ)言中的for循環(huán)        113
5.5 數(shù)組        118
5.6 其他:流水線        123
本章小結(jié)        124
第6章  過(guò)程        126
6.1 80x86堆棧        126
6.2 過(guò)程體、調(diào)用和返回        131
6.3 參數(shù)和局部變量        138
6.4 遞歸        145
6.5 其他體系結(jié)構(gòu):沒(méi)有堆棧的過(guò)程        149
本章小結(jié)        150
第7章  串操作        151
7.1 串指令        151
7.2 重復(fù)前綴和其他串指令        156
7.3 字符轉(zhuǎn)換        166
7.4 二進(jìn)制補(bǔ)碼整數(shù)轉(zhuǎn)換為ASCII碼串        169
7.5 其他體系結(jié)構(gòu): CISC和RISC設(shè)計(jì)        172
本章小結(jié)        173
第8章  位運(yùn)算        174
8.1 邏輯運(yùn)算        174
8.2 移位和循環(huán)移位指令        181
8.3 ASCII字符串到二進(jìn)制補(bǔ)碼整數(shù)的轉(zhuǎn)換        190
8.4 硬件級(jí)—邏輯門        194
本章小結(jié)        195
第9章  匯編過(guò)程        197
9.1 兩次掃描匯編和一次掃描匯編        197
9.2 80x86指令編碼        200
9.3 宏定義及其展開        209
9.4 條件匯編        213
9.5 IO.H中的宏        218
本章小結(jié)        221
第10章  浮點(diǎn)數(shù)運(yùn)算        222
10.1 80x86浮點(diǎn)數(shù)結(jié)構(gòu)        222
10.2 浮點(diǎn)型指令編程        234
10.3 浮點(diǎn)數(shù)的模擬        245
10.4 浮點(diǎn)數(shù)和嵌入式匯編        252
本章小結(jié)        253
第11章  十進(jìn)制數(shù)運(yùn)算        254
11.1 壓縮的BCD碼表示        254
11.2 壓縮的BCD碼指令        260
11.3 未壓縮的BCD碼表示和指令        266
11.4 其他體系結(jié)構(gòu):VAX壓縮的十進(jìn)制指令        274
本章小結(jié)        275
第12章  輸入/輸出        276
12.1 使用kernel32庫(kù)的控制臺(tái)輸入/輸出        276
12.2 使用Kernel 32庫(kù)的連續(xù)文件的輸入/輸出        282
12.3 低級(jí)輸入/輸出        288
本章小結(jié)        289
附錄A  十六進(jìn)制/ASCII碼的轉(zhuǎn)換        291
附錄B  常用的MS-DOS命令        293
附錄C  MASM 6.11保留字        294
附錄D  80x86指令(帶助記符)        298
附錄E  80x86指令(帶操作碼)        316

本目錄推薦

掃描二維碼
Copyright ? 讀書網(wǎng) ranfinancial.com 2005-2020, All Rights Reserved.
鄂ICP備15019699號(hào) 鄂公網(wǎng)安備 42010302001612號(hào)